All patients with COVID-19 who met criteria for critical care admission from AdventHealth hospitals were transferred and managed at AdventHealth Orlando, a 1368-bed hospital with 170 ICU beds and dedicated inhouse 24/7 intensivist coverage. NIRS treatments were applied continuously for at least 48h while controlling oxygen delivery to obtain a target oxygen saturation measured by pulse oximetry (SpO2) of 9296%21. To assess the potential impact of NIRS treatment settings, we compared outcomes within NIRS-group according to: flow in the HFNC group (>50 vs.50 L/min), pressure in the CPAP group (>10 vs.10cm H2O), and PEEP in the NIV group (>10 vs.10cm H2O). Based on recent reports showing hypercoagulable state and increased risk of thrombosis in patients with COVID-19, deep vein thrombosis (DVT) prophylaxis was initiated by following an institutional algorithm that employed D-dimer levels and rotational thromboelastometry (ROTEM) to determine the risk of thrombosis [19]. We aimed to compare the outcome of patients with COVID-19 pneumonia and hypoxemic respiratory failure treated with high-flow oxygen administered via nasal cannula (HFNC), continuous positive airway pressure (CPAP) or noninvasive ventilation (NIV), initiated outside the intensive care unit (ICU) in 10 university hospitals in Catalonia, Spain. Multivariable Cox proportional-hazards regression models were used to estimate the hazard ratios (HR) for patients treated with NIV and CPAP as compared to HFNC (the reference group), adjusting for age, sex, and variables found to be significantly different between treatments at baseline (hospital, date of admission and sleep apnea). In the NIV group, a pressure support ventilator mode was adjusted; a high positive end-expiratory pressure (PEEP) and a low support pressure were used to set a tidal volume<9ml/kg of predicted body weight8. Median C-reactive protein on hospital admission was 115 mg/L (IQR 59.3186.3; upper limit of normal 5 mg/L), median Ferritin was 848 ng/ml (IQR 4411541); upper limit of normal 336 ng/ml), D-dimer was 1.4 ug/mL (IQR 0.83.2; upper limit of normal 0.8 ug/mL), and IL-6 level was 18 pg/mL (IQR 746.5; upper limit of normal 2 pg/mL).
